1.

What can be the maximum diameter of the pipe for the water flow of velocity 1 m/s ( = 10-6) to be laminar in nature? Assume Lower critical Reynolds number to be 2100.

A. 2.1 mm
B. 21 mm
C. 21 cm
D. 0.21 mm
Answer» B. 21 mm
